Hello,

I need to find out how much transmission fluid needs to be put into A170, 2001, 1.7 CDi - transmission model 423 (5 speed manual).

Long story Short: My car was serviced in MB authorized service, and started to act up. Eventually, after two more visits in MB service, I decided to go to unauthorized, but well known Automatic transmission specialist. His verdict is scary - When MB was changing transmission fluid, they supposedly poured in less oil than is needed. According to the invoice from MB service place, they poured in 3 liters. However he claims that there should be 5,5 liters poured in during the change. This checks out with the sources I was able to find online, but I want to double check with someone more experienced, since I am no mechanic. As a result some of the bearings in the transmission got damaged and approximate cost of repair is 1000 pounds.

Please, can someone advice me, how much oil needs to be put into the transmission when being changed? Thank you

It really depends on whether or not they drained the torque converter.

If not, they only need to put in a lesser amount.

However, it is entirely possible they put in the wrong amount or some leaked out somehow....

My car leaked fluid from the gearbox pilot bushing (basically a plug/socket for the wiring to enter the box) and as the fluid level dropped, I was having issues with the box not changing up upon hard acceleration. I measured the fluid level and found it lacking by 1 litre. I topped it up and away it went.

You can buy a dipstick off ebay http://www.ebay.co.uk/itm/Auto-Gear...137350?hash=item2a4f6c80c6:g:McoAAOSwuTxV-mV-


But you REALLY need someone who knows what they are doing to use it.
